Acemagic has debuted its flagship F9A mini PC, which features a Ryzen AI Max+ 395 processor, capable of delivering up to 126 AI TOPS. This ultra-compact system is housed in a 2-liter chassis, providing powerful performance for both gaming and AI workloads. Equipped with modern connectivity options, including USB4 ports, it caters to high-speed peripherals and offers flexibility with the addition of a discrete GPU through an OCulink port. The F9A also combines an attractive design with a dedicated key to enhance AI productivity.
